Hello,
Hitex is producing emulators. The corresponding software-debugging tool
needs to evaluate the debug format of non-relocatable file. Therefor we are
using a symbol preprocessor which transforms the special debug format into
our Hitex debug format.
One of our customers Mr. Reck (address@hidden) told us about
problems he has with the symbol preprocessor for the Elf-Dwarf 2.0 and an
output produced by the GNU C 2.8.1- Compiler.
He sent us the following attached two examples in which errors occur.
<<taskHook.out>> <<isrDemo.out>>
Investigating the problem we found out that something is wrong in the debug
output.
In the first example 'isrDemo' we get an Read-Error because the length of
debuginformation for the modul is not correct. If we correct the length
manually we get an error during the evaluation of the line information
because the offset to the lineinformation is wrong.
In the second example 'taskHook' we get an Error while searching for the
abbreviation code 84 which is not defined. In this example also the tool
'mdump.exe' cancels during evaluation.
